CBB Exclusive: A second daughter for Sarah McLachlan

Tags: Births, Exclusive

Sarahmclachlan_122310_cbbUpdate: Sarah’s publicist has released an announcement saying the baby was born June 22nd in Vancouver.

The family is overjoyed to welcome this newest addition to their family. Both mother and baby are happy and healthy.

Source: Yahoo Canada

Update July 11th: We hear baby’s name is Taja Summer and she was born on or around June 23rd. Taja, pronounced ‘Taa-jah’ is a Hindi name meaning ‘crown.’

Originally posted June 30th: We hear that Sarah McLachlan, 39, and her husband Ashwin Sood welcomed their second daughter last week. The new baby joins big sister India Ann Sushil, 5.
